Thought you might be interested in a copy of the 20-page ruling issued this
week by a Denver County judge that found the photo radar program had
violated both state and local laws. The judge issued a motion to dismiss
the tickets of 4 defendants challenging the system, and the city has been
forced to turn off the cameras. The ruling tracks perfectly with the two
separate California Superior Court rulings that shut down San Diego's red
light camera system. The tide may be turning.

"And it's true in a few intersections we found a few more accidents than
prior to the red light photo enforcement. At some intersections we saw no
change at all, and at several intersections we actually saw an increase in
traffic accidents." -- San Diego Police Chief David Bejarano, Nightline,
7/30/01
"I would have to say that the cameras themselves have not reduced the number
of (injury) collisions that have happened at these intersections," said
Elizabeth Yard, an analyst with the San Diego Police Department's traffic
division. -- San Diego Union-Tribune, 9/2/01
